The Pacific Institute for Climate Solutions and Science in Action are looking for students to help out at their workshops for grade 4–7 students.

Children from grades 4 to 7 have a hands-on opportunity to explore different ways to generate “green” energy using wind, sun and water as a power source. The program looks at topics such as generating electricity from renewable sources, finding out how much energy is required to light different kinds of bulbs while pedaling a bike, and learning about the effects of green house gases on the climate.

This volunteer opportunity (see poster) would give you a chance to practice your presentation skills and get you connected to others at SFU who are involved in climate initiatives.
